Wisconsin Field Crops Pathology Fungicide Tests Summary

By Damon L. Smith
 
This report is a concise summary of pesticide related research trials conducted in 2017 under the direction of the Wisconsin Field Crops Pathology program in the Department of Plant Pathology at the University of Wisconsin-Madison.
